Why Remove Solar Panels?
There are several reasons why solar panels may need to be removed. These include upgrading to more efficient panels, replacing damaged panels, relocating solar arrays, or decommissioning old systems. Proper removal ensures that the panels can be reused or recycled, reducing waste and maximizing their lifespan.
Proper Removal Techniques
When it comes to removing solar panels, it is important to follow industry best practices to ensure safety and efficiency. Here are some key steps to consider:
- Shut off all power sources and disconnect the panels from the system.
- Secure the panels to prevent any accidents or damage during removal.
- Carefully uninstall the panels and store them in a safe location.
- Dispose of any damaged panels properly and recycle materials whenever possible.
